1. What are Standard Cables?
Standard cables are the most commonly used cable types for typical electrical applications. They are designed to meet basic electrical standards and are suitable for general use in homes, offices, and industrial settings.
2. What are Special Cables?
Special Cables, on the other hand, are designed for specific applications that may require enhanced performance or unique features. These cables can be tailored to withstand harsh environments, high temperatures, or specialized electrical requirements.
3. What advantages do Special Cables offer over Standard Cables?
Special Cables come with several advantages that can make them more suitable for certain applications:

- Enhanced Durability: Many Special Cables are designed to resist chemicals, moisture, and extreme temperatures, making them more durable in challenging environments.
- Increased Safety: Certain Special Cables are made with fire-resistant materials, reducing the risk of fire hazards in case of electrical faults.
- Improved Performance: Special Cables are often engineered for high-performance applications, delivering better conductivity and reduced signal loss.
- Specific Compliance: They may meet particular industry standards, making them ideal for specialized sectors such as medical, automotive, or aerospace.
4. When should you use Standard Cables instead of Special Cables?
While Special Cables have their benefits, there are situations where Standard Cables may be more appropriate:
- Cost-Effectiveness: Standard Cables are generally cheaper and are adequate for most common uses, making them ideal for budget-conscious projects.
- Availability: Standard Cables are widely available and easy to find, reducing the lead time for projects.
- Simpler Installation: They are often easier to install, as they don’t require special handling or knowledge about unique features.
5. How do you decide between Special Cables and Standard Cables?
Choosing the right type of cable depends on the specific requirements of your project:
- Assess Your Environment: Consider factors like temperature, moisture, and exposure to chemicals.
- Evaluate Performance Needs: Determine if you require enhanced performance features such as better conductivity or speed.
- Consider Safety Requirements: Understand the safety standards required for your application, especially in commercial or industrial settings.
- Budget Constraints: Factor in the cost differences between Standard and Special Cables and decide what fits into your budget.
6. Are there any downsides to using Special Cables?
While Special Cables can offer exceptional benefits, there are also some potential downsides:
- Higher Cost: They tend to be more expensive than Standard Cables, which may not be justified for all applications.
- Complexity: Installation can be more complex, often requiring specialized knowledge or tools.
